        I've had stitches and stitch "threats" on and off for a while.  Maybe I'm not using the right term -- I mean like a cramp in an abdominal muscle, anywhere from midline to toward the hip crest, beltline to a couple fingers below.  Anyway, I ran some 200 pickups back on 04JUL.  Last one was downhill, and I think I leaned back some and overstrode after I finished it.  My right adductor was a little tight for a couple days, no big deal.  Two days later, I ran an easy 11mi.  That evening, my groin was KILLING me.  Centered at the pubic bone, maybe slightly to the right.

         

        I thought (hoped?) it was just tendinitis, so I eased off to let it recover.  It hasn't.

          I would visit that Doctor that you had success with in treating some of your prior ailments. From what you describe it sounds a lot like what I had two years ago when I dislocated my pubic bone (or a hernia). You can dislocate your pubic bone if you do certain (extreme) stretching or place stress/force in that area (plyometrics) and combine that with running 40-50 miles per week including workouts. The hip flexor pain I had was intense and along the hip crestline. I went to my orthopedic who had no idea. I then immediately went to my PT who diagnosed it within 2 min and popped it back into place (not a fun procedure). After a week off I was able to resume running. However, the pain persisted in the hip flexor and soft tissues for another 3-4 months (it would hurt like crazy for the first 4-5 minutes and then go away, and fortunately over time that period of pain decreased).
